Abeche Airport (AEH) to Jeddah (JED)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Abeche Airport (AEH) in Abeche Airport, Chad to King Abdulaziz International Airport (JED) in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ia is 2,124 kilometers (1,320 miles / 1,147 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ying east northeast at a heading of 63°.
